ID:381600

昭昭

java高级,系统架构

  • 公司信息:
  • 天翼电子商务有限公司
  • 工作经验:
  • 7年
  • 兼职日薪:
  • 500元/8小时
  • 兼职时间:
  • 下班后
  • 周六
  • 周日
  • 所在区域:
  • 上海
  • 浦东

技术能力

熟练掌握主流开发框架,有Dubbo,springboot,springcloud,Spring-MVC,SSM(Spring+Spring-MVC+MyBatis),SSH(Spring+Spring-MVC+Hibernate)项目开发经验,可以快速上手新型框架。
熟练掌握关系型数据库MySQL,OB的使用,熟练掌握sharding-jdbc,MyCat数据库中间件,熟悉数据库的设计优化方案,了解Oracle的使用。
熟练掌握非关系型数据库Redis的使用,可以利用Redis实现缓存,分布式锁,分布式session等。
熟悉消息中间件RabbitMQ,RocketMQ以及Kafka底层原理;熟练使用分布式定时任务调度平台Elastic-Job,XXL-Job;熟练掌握全文搜索引擎ElasticSearch以及Solr的使用;熟练掌握Zookeeper的基础原理。
深入理解Java虚拟机底层原理,深入了解java编程思想,包括反射机制,类加载机制等。
熟练掌握常用的设计模式。
熟练掌握使用Docker+Jenkins进行软件测试与开发。
熟练掌握Linux操作系统的使用,熟悉Linux命令。
具备优秀的系统架构设计能力,可以针对性的解决系统问题,进行系统优化。
具备优秀的代码逻辑编写能力,系统优化能力。
具有较强的逻辑思维能力,学习能力,善于把握复杂事物,对细节难题具备快速钻研解决能力。

项目经验

项目名称:微贷统一风控平台
开发周期:2020.11-2021.05
软件环境:Spring-MVC、DUBBO、MyBatis、MySQL、Redis、Elastic-Job、Kafka
项目简介:
随着公司信贷业务的扩展,以及响应公司的发展战略,对前端业务板块进行重组,重新搭建了公司级的微贷风控体系,作为微贷风控中台,需要兼容多个部门的需求,建立各种风险控制规则,减少受到外部各种不确定因素的影响,资产蒙受经济损失的可能性。
主要功能模块为:
前置应用:流程的场景,事件,组件的配置,以及串联。
风控核心平台:与规则平台交互以组件为维度,需要使用流程引擎将各个组件串联起来。
规则平台:将规则转为drools文件,并且使用drools规则引擎执行规则。
变量平台:提供各种离线变量以及实时变量支持,
数据接入平台:为变量提供数据源支持的数据中心
责任描述:
主要负责规则组件模块的需求评审,接口设计,接口文档编写,数据库设计,并且开发落地。包括规则集模块,评分卡模块(标准评分卡+复杂评分卡),决策表模块(交叉决策表+多维决策表)。同时帮助同事解决一些问题,包括代码结构优化,以及代码设计的建设等。

项目名称:翼支付借钱融合平台
开发周期:2019.03-2019.10
软件环境:Spring-MVC、DUBBO、MyBatis、MySQL、Redis、Elastic-Job、Kafka
项目简介:
随着业务的发展以及部门的融合,原先简单的项目架构已经不满足目前的业务需求,需搭建一个覆盖信贷业务全流程的信贷体系。目前有个人贷款,员工贷,甜橙白条等业务线,涉及到的主要业务阶段为授信,借款,还款等。
本项目使用Spring-MVC+Dubbo+Mybatis+Redis进行分布式开发,前端使用Vue,使用Mybatis作为数据库中间件存储持久化订单信息,用户信息等,使用Redis作为缓存,存储经常使用的配置信息,以及使用Redis用作分布式锁,防止高并发带来的数据错乱问题。使用Elastic-Job进行定时任务的管理。使用Kafka作为消息中间件,实现各个阶段的解耦以及和不同业务上的交互。
涉及的应用有:授信中心,借据中心,还款计划中心,公共服务,产品层,接入层等。
责任描述:
主要进行产品层,接入层,授信中心,借据中心,公共服务等应用的开发,参与了授信借款流程以及公共能力的需求的分析,数据库设计,接口设计以及代码的落地,包括授信申请流程,借款申请流程,以及公共能力的提供。


项目名称:借钱产品分模块割接新一代
开发周期:2024.01-至今
软件环境:Spring-boot、DUBBO、Nacos、MyBatis、OceanBase、Redis、XXL-Job、RocketMQ
项目简介:
在公司推进新一代技术割接的大背景下,我们部门迅速行动起来,积极响应公司的号召,进行了借钱产品的割接任务。
借钱产品是一个专为个人用户设计的信贷产品,它提供了一个全面的金融服务解决方案。用户可以通过这个产品进行授信操作,获得一定的信用额度,进而进行借款。当用户需要流动资金时,这个产品能够迅速提供所需资金,满足其短期或长期的财务需求。
在借款周期内,用户还可以享受到灵活的还款选项,包括分期还款或一次性还清,这样可以根据用户的财务状况和偏好来定制还款计划。
此外,为了增加信贷业务的安全性和减少逾期风险,该产品还提供了担保与反担保机制。确保了信贷业务的每个环节都得到了妥善管理,从借款、还款到担保和反担保,每一步骤都有严格的控制和风险管理。这不仅增强了信贷机构的信心,也鼓励了更多的用户参与到信贷市场中,因为他们知道有额外的保障措施来保护自己免受意外的金融风险。
该产品还拥有自己的风控定价体系。这个体系利用先进的数据分析技术和算法,根据用户的信用历史、还款能力、借贷行为以及其他相关因素,对每位用户进行个性化的风险评估。基于这些评估结果,借钱产品能够为用户提供灵活的定价方案,确保利率既能反映市场条件,又能适应个别用户的风险水平。这种动态的、个性化的定价策略旨在优化用户体验,同时保护金融机构的利益,实现风险管理和收益最大化的平衡。

责任描述:
作为新一代开拓组的小组长,负责新一代白条业务的架构设计,完成了白条产品的整体设计,并带领小组成员完成业务的开发与割接工作。
由于借钱产品时一个体量很大的产品,他有二十多个可以处理信贷业务的下游合作方,还有十几个资产来源上游的的渠道方,各个合作方还有一些特殊逻辑,而授信模块可以同时走两个合作方的特殊业务,所以我们采用了授信模块基于渠道割接,其他模块基于合作方割接方案。
设计并完成了授信模块的割接方案,绑卡模块的割接方案,梳理需要割接的合作方的业务流程,基于新一代的设计思路完成合作方的整体割接,编写并检查割接脚本,最终完成借钱产品的业务割接。

信用行为

  • 接单
    0
  • 评价
    0
  • 收藏
    0
微信扫码,建群沟通

发布任务

企业点击发布任务,工程师会在任务下报名,招聘专员也会在1小时内与您联系,1小时内精准确定人才

微信接收人才推送

关注猿急送微信平台,接收实时人才推送

接收人才推送
联系需求方端客服
联系需求方端客服